Multiple Latch Command
The Multiple Latch command extends the capabilities of the Count
Latch command. The Multiple Latch command is used to selectively
latch the count and status of any or all counter/timers simultaneously.
This command is the only method of reading the status of a
counter/timer.
Once the status or count is latched with this command, it is unaffected
by further latch commands. The latched data must be read or the
counter/timer reinitialized before the Count Latch and Status Latch
will resume tracking the operation of the Down Counter.
The count and status must be read according to the Read/Write Mode
programmed for the selected counter/timer. Two read operations are
required if the Read/Write Mode specifies two-byte operation and the
status is not latched. The first read is for the low byte of the count and
the second for the high byte. If the status is latched, three read
operations are required with the status being the first byte read,
followed by the low and then the high bytes of the count. One read
operation is all that is needed for single-byte mode, if the status is not
latched. For single-byte operations with latched status, two read
operations are needed, the first for the status and the second for the
data.
